Dentsu Inc. Subsidiary Cyber Communications, Inc. Joins Lead Investor Samsung Venture Investment Corporation as New Investor in OpenX Series E Round

Total Investment in OpenX Exceeds $75 Million

LOS ANGELES, February 26, 2013 OpenX Software Ltd. (OpenX), a global leader in digital and mobile advertising revenue products and services, today announced it has closed additional financing in its Series E round with funding from new investor cyber communications, inc. (cci), Japan’s leading media representative company and a wholly owned subsidiary of Dentsu Inc. (TYO: JP: 4324) (Dentsu). The new investment brings the total investment in OpenX to more than $75 million. The Series E round was announced in January 2013 and was led by new investor Samsung Venture Investment Corporation, which manages investment and investment-related activities for Samsung affiliate companies. Existing investors Accel Partners, Index Ventures, SAP Ventures, Mitsui & Co. Global Investment, Inc., and Presidio Ventures, the wholly owned investment vehicle of Sumitomo Corporation, also participated in the round. OpenX will use the funds to further accelerate growth, finance additional acquisitions, expand internationally and broaden adoption of its digital revenue platform.

OpenX’s products enable digital media companies to maximize their ad revenue on any digitally connected screen. The company has grown rapidly since its May 2011 Series D funding round, achieving greater than 100% year-over-year revenue growth in both 2011 and 2012. In 2012, OpenX also completed two acquisitions – LiftDNA and JumpTime – both of which further OpenX’s mission to maximize ad revenue for digital media companies. To drive this growth, during 2012 OpenX doubled its team to more than 260 employees, expanded to five datacenters on three continents and opened new offices in New York, London and Tokyo as well as opening a new 45,000 square foot headquarters in Los Angeles.

A key driver of OpenX’s growth has been the global adoption of its pioneering Real-Time Bidding (RTB) exchange, OpenX Market (Market). OpenX was one of the first proponents of RTB and is now one of its leading providers: Market now processes more than one million bids per second at peak. Now 95% of the nation’s leading advertisers participate in Market. In 2012, OpenX served nearly four trillion ad transactions, a 300% increase over 2011.

In partnership with OpenX, cci operates the exchange as OpenX Market Japan, the first marketplace in the region to offer RTB functionality. cci supplies both Web-based and mobile inventory, including both smartphone and tablet inventory, from online and mobile publishers. Advertising agencies and Demand Side Platforms bid on the inventory in the RTB exchange. OpenX Market Japan handles many billions of impressions monthly.
